Chris Bambridge

Born in 1947, Chris Bambridge came to Australia from Britain in 1974. A Grade One referee, Bambridge was appointed to the national league in 1977, where he stayed until his retirement in 1991. He was awarded the FIFA badge in 1981, gaining selection to the panel of linesmen for the World Youth finals in Australia that year. Following his appointment as linesman for the quarter finals, semi-finals and final of the 1983 Mexico World Youth championship, Bambridge refereed the final of the 1985 World Youth title in China. He was also selected for the 1986 World Cup finals in Mexico and the 1988 Olympic Games in South Korea, becoming the only Australian referee to have taken part in both World Cup and Olympic Games finals. In addition to his international duties, Bambridge refereed four national league grand finals and was twice elected Australian Referee of the Year. After retiring from active refereeing, Bambridge switched to administration to become president of Soccer Referees Victoria.
